Kevin Nolte
Chicago, IL
kevin.nolte@ccpwealth.com

Kevin is the Manager of Advanced Planning at Clearwater Capital Partners, a $1 billion+ independent Registered Investment Advisory firm in the Greater Chicago Area. He provides tailored solutions to help clients progress towards their financial and strategic goals. His areas of focus include business transfer planning, estate strategy, and tax optimization.

Starting his professional career at Ernst & Young (EY), he worked in EY’s Wealth and Asset Management Assurance group for several years. His many clients included Chicago-based private equity funds, hedge funds, and family offices. After leaving EY, Kevin built out and oversaw a single-family office, where he guided the family in their business ventures managing over $500 million in assets. Across all these roles, Kevin successfully navigated many of the complex circumstances that ultra-high-net-worth individuals and families face.

Originally from Wisconsin, Kevin now lives in the Chicago area. He graduated Cum Laude from Marquette University with a degree in business administration, majoring in both Accounting and Information Technology. While at Marquette, Kevin was invited to join the National Jesuit Honor Society, Alpha Sigma Nu, as a testament to his academic success and commitment to service.

Natalie Perry
Chicago, IL
nperry@harrisonllp.com

Natalie Perry is a Partner at Harrison LLP in Chicago. As both an attorney and registered Certified Public Accountant, Natalie advises clients on strategies for achieving tax-efficient estate planning as well as income tax planning. She helps clients structure entities for tax purposes, including family limited partnerships, and advises clients on succession planning.

As an extension of her deep concentration in estate planning, Natalie also has experience in crafting settlements to resolve trust disputes and in representing trustees and beneficiaries in contested proceedings, including through the process of mediation. She also advises trustees, executors and beneficiaries in trust and probate administration, including handling IRS audits.

Natalie started her career as a CPA prior to attending law school. For several years, she advised closely held businesses in her role as tax consultant for a large public accounting firm.

Natalie is a frequent speaker at professional education events for attorneys and accountants. Natalie is a Fellow of the American College of Trust and Estate Counsel (ACTEC) and chairs its Communications Committee. She is a former board member of the Chicago Estate Planning Council. She currently serves on the Executive Committee of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A).

From 2018 through 2020, Natalie was Chair of the Hinsdale Hospital Foundation. Natalie received her B.S., in Accounting from Indiana University, and her J.D. from DePaul University.

Laura Rossi
Chicago, IL
laura.rossi@ey.com

Laura Rossi is a Managing Director in Tax with the EY Private practice in Chicago, Illinois. With over 24 years of experience, she advises ultra-high net-worth individuals, multi-generational families, family businesses and family offices, providing a holistic approach to their complex tax and financial needs, including compliance, reporting, tax and financial planning. Laura is a recipient of the AICPA’s 2017 Personal Financial Planning (PFP) Standing Ovation Award, which honors young CPAs for their contributions to personal financial planning. She is a founding member of the Associate Board for the Girl Scouts of Greater Chicago and Northwest Indiana and is also a founding member of the Chicago chapter of Chief. Laura is a Certified Public Accountant in Illinois (CPAs), a Certified Financial Planner (CFP®) and a Personal Financial Specialist (PFS™). She is a member of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ants, the Illinois Society of CPAs and the Financial Planning Association.
